Can I upgrade to Windows Vista or Windows 7?

I have a HP Pavilion 523n 2002, which has an AMD Athlon 1.67 GHz microprocessor.   He has been up with 2 GB of memory, hard drives 150 MB and 320 MB, a Startech USB 2.0/IEEE1394 PCI card and a video card ATI all-in-Wonder 7500/64 MB DDR AGP.  It came with Windows XP Home Edition is installed.  Is it possible to upgrade my computer with Windows Vista or Windows 7?

Hello:

I do not think because the video card is not windows Vista or 7 capable. There may be other hardware not able either.

The best thing to do is to download and run the Upgrade Advisor free windows 7, which will signal the backward compatibility of your PC with windows 7.

http://Windows.Microsoft.com/en-us/Windows/downloads/Upgrade-Advisor

Plug in and turn on any peripheral equipment (printers, scanners, etc.), you, and she will report on their compatibility too.
